About NorthLight School:
At NorthLight School, we believe in nurturing confident and engaged learners with a passion for lifelong learning.

Our curriculum is designed to be practice-oriented and values-driven, helping students gain not only academic knowledge but also practical skills and strong character.

We are seeking passionate educators and leaders who are committed to making a positive difference in the lives of our students.

Role and Responsibilities:

  • Develop and deliver engaging and effective English lessons that meet the needs of students at their levels of proficiency.

  • Create and maintain an inviting and safe classroom environment that fosters learning and encourages student participation.

  • Monitor student progress and provide regular feedback on academic performance, behavior, and other relevant areas.

  • Collaborate with other teachers and staff to ensure that students receive a well-rounded educational experience that promotes their overall academic success.

  • Participate in professional development opportunities to keep up-to-date with the latest teaching techniques, technologies, and best practices in the field of English education.

  • Communicate regularly with parents, guardians, and other stakeholders to keep them informed of student progress and any issues that may arise.

  • Prepare and administer assessments to evaluate student learning and provide feedback to students and parents.

  • Maintain accurate and up-to-date records of student grades, attendance, and other relevant data.

  • Participate in co-curricular activities with students and actively contribute to the committee involved.

Personal Competencies, Qualifications and Experiences:

  • Teaching qualification attained from institutions, e.g. National Institute of Education, International Baccalaureate, or Cambridge International Education is required.

  • At least 3 years of relevant teaching experience, preferably in an education institution.

  • Good team player with excellent interpersonal and communication skills.

  • Good classroom management skills with a strong passion for student development.

What we can offer:·

  • A unique opportunity to make a meaningful impact on the lives of students
  • 5-day work week
  • School holidays leave scheme and competitive employee benefits
  • Professional learning and development opportunities
